Knee and Thigh Swelling: Diagnostic Approach and Management
For knee and thigh swelling, obtain plain radiographs immediately (AP, lateral, tunnel, and sunrise views) to exclude fracture, tumor, or infection, followed by targeted evaluation based on clinical features to distinguish between infectious, inflammatory, vascular, and structural causes. 1
Immediate Clinical Assessment
Critical features to evaluate:
- Assess for warmth, tenderness, and erythema overlying the swelling to distinguish infectious from non-infectious causes 1, 2
- Evaluate for fluctuance indicating abscess formation that would require drainage 1, 2
- Check for signs of systemic toxicity including fever >38°C, tachycardia, and altered mental status 1, 2
- Palpate for unilateral versus bilateral involvement, as bilateral swelling suggests systemic causes (heart failure, renal disease, liver disease, medications) rather than local pathology 3
- Examine for joint effusion by assessing knee fullness and loss of normal contours 1
- Document duration and progression: rapid onset (<7 days) suggests acute bacterial infection, while gradual onset may indicate chronic processes 1
Initial Imaging Strategy
Plain radiographs are mandatory as the first imaging study for any persistent knee or thigh swelling 1:
- Radiographs exclude fractures and tumors as causes of swelling or pain 1
- In early acute osteomyelitis (<14 days), radiographs may show only mild soft tissue swelling 1
- Soft tissue swelling, joint effusion, and effacement of fat planes may indicate infection 1
- Obtain AP, lateral, sunrise/Merchant, and tunnel views for comprehensive knee evaluation 1
If radiographs are normal or show only soft tissue swelling/effusion, proceed to MRI of the entire compartment with adjacent joints for suspected infection or structural pathology 1
Key Differential Diagnoses by Clinical Pattern
Unilateral Knee and Thigh Swelling with Acute Onset
Infectious causes (highest priority):
- Septic arthritis: presents with warmth, erythema, severe pain, and inability to bear weight 1, 4
- Soft tissue infection/pyomyositis: thigh swelling with tenderness extending beyond the joint 1, 5
- Osteomyelitis: persistent pain with systemic symptoms 1
If infection is suspected, perform joint aspiration under image guidance (ultrasound or fluoroscopy) for culture and analysis before starting antibiotics 1:
- Aspiration confirms diagnosis and identifies the organism 1
- Image guidance ensures proper needle placement and reduces complications 1
- Send samples for microbiological culture in all cases 1
Unilateral Swelling with Trauma History or Mechanical Symptoms
Structural abnormalities:
- Osteochondritis dissecans: presents with pain, swelling, locking, catching, popping, or giving way 1
- Meniscal pathology or ligament injury: MRI indicated when concomitant pathology suspected 1
- Popliteal artery aneurysm or pseudoaneurysm: rare but critical, presents as pulsatile mass with pain 6, 5
Bilateral Knee and Thigh Swelling
Systemic causes take precedence 3:
- Heart failure: increased central venous pressure causing bilateral edema that worsens throughout the day and with standing 3
- Renal disease: protein loss leading to decreased oncotic pressure 3
- Liver disease: decreased albumin synthesis 3
- Medications: calcium channel blockers, NSAIDs, thiazolidinediones 3
Initial laboratory workup for bilateral swelling 3:
- BNP/NT-proBNP for heart failure 3
- Creatinine and urinalysis for renal function 3
- Liver function tests and albumin 3
- Consider venous duplex ultrasound to exclude bilateral deep vein thrombosis 3
Special Populations
In diabetic patients with acute thigh and knee pain:
- Consider diabetic muscle infarction (diabetic myonecrosis), which presents with abrupt onset pain, thigh swelling, and inability to bear weight, mimicking septic arthritis 7
- MRI shows heterogeneously hyperintense muscle on T2-weighted imaging 7
- Treatment is conservative with analgesics and physiotherapy 7
In children with recent vaccination:
- DTaP vaccine reaction causes entire thigh swelling in 1.2-3.2% after fourth or fifth doses, beginning within 48 hours and lasting 3.9 days 3
- This resolves completely without sequelae 3
Advanced Imaging Indications
CT with IV contrast is indicated when 1:
- Ultrasound or MRI is inconclusive 1
- Deep space infection is suspected 1
- Evaluation of soft tissue compartments and extent of infection is needed to guide surgical debridement 1
MRI is preferred over CT for evaluating soft tissue and bone marrow pathology, structural knee abnormalities, and characterizing lesions 1
Management Based on Etiology
Suspected Infection
Immediate referral to orthopedics or infectious disease for suspected septic arthritis or osteomyelitis 1:
- Image-guided aspiration for culture 1
- Empiric IV antibiotics after cultures obtained 1
- Surgical debridement if abscess present 1
Inflammatory Arthritis
For non-infectious inflammatory causes 1:
- NSAIDs (oral or topical) for symptomatic relief 1, 8
- Avoid NSAIDs in patients with cardiovascular disease, renal impairment, or GI bleeding history 8
- Physical therapy and low-impact exercise 1
Structural Abnormalities
Orthopedic referral for definitive management of meniscal tears, ligament injuries, or osteochondritis dissecans 1
Systemic Causes
Treat underlying condition (heart failure, renal disease, liver disease) and consider medication adjustment if drug-induced 3
Critical Pitfalls to Avoid
- Do not dismiss persistent bone pain lasting more than a few weeks, as this warrants immediate investigation for malignancy or infection 1
- Recent trauma does not rule out malignant tumor and must not prevent appropriate diagnostic procedures 1
- In patients over 40 years, destructive bone lesions are most commonly metastasis or myeloma, not primary bone tumors 1
- All suspected primary malignant bone tumors require referral to a specialized center before biopsy 1
- Bilateral swelling with unilateral symptoms of DVT (pain, warmth, erythema) requires urgent venous duplex to exclude thrombosis 1, 3
